It’s the curse of Marge Schott (Sadly, this is not from the Babylon Bee)

Not everyone was as thoughtful as Barry Larkin, Eric Davis, and Ray Knight. Reds owner Marge Schott felt that this had all happened to her.her.

“I feel cheated,” said Schott, “This isn’t supposed to happen to us, not in Cincinnati. This is our day, our tradition, our team.” It had snowed that morning, threatening Opening Day, and Schott said “First snow, now this.” Schott called the National League office and complained to Vice President Katy Feeney, saying “This is screwy, I’m telling you . . . you can’t imagine the boos that are going on here. Why can’t we play the game? This man wouldn’t want to disappoint 50,000 fans.” Schott later said, “We’ll never play on April Fools’ Day again,” Schott said later.

A month later Schott would be caught on camera praising Adolf Hitler, saying “Everybody knows he was good at the beginning but he just went too far.” She would be suspended from active ownership for two years.
